Q: Is 605,206 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 605,206 is a composite number.

Why is 605,206 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 605,206 can be evenly divided by 1 2 7 14 139 278 311 622 973 1,946 2,177 4,354 43,229 86,458 302,603 and 605,206, with no remainder.

Since 605,206 cannot be divided by just 1 and 605,206, it is a composite number.
